Skip to main content

一部の env 専用の設定オプションがサーバー設定で管理されるようになりました

AI Marketer 5では、AI Marketer v4で環境変数でのみ管理されていた一部の設定オプションがサーバー設定ファイルで管理されるようになりました。

This page is part of the breaking changes database and provides information about the breaking change and additional instructions to migrate from Strapi v4 to Strapi 5.

🔌 Is this breaking change affecting plugins?No
🤖 Is this breaking change automatically handled by a codemod?No

互換性のない変更の説明

AI Marketer v4では

以下の設定は環境変数からのみ利用可能です:

  • AI Marketer_DISABLE_REMOTE_DATA_TRANSFER
  • AI Marketer_DISABLE_UPDATE_NOTIFICATION
  • AI Marketer_HIDE_STARTUP_MESSAGE

AI Marketer 5では

これらの設定オプションはサーバー設定ファイルに移行されました(詳細は以下の表を参照してください)。


移行手順

This section regroups useful notes and procedures about the introduced breaking change.

注意事項

AI Marketer v4で使用されていた以下の環境変数は、AI Marketer 5では/config/server.js設定ファイル内で定義する必要があります:

AI Marketer v4での環境変数名AI Marketer 5でのサーバー設定オプション
AI Marketer_DISABLE_REMOTE_DATA_TRANSFERtransfer.remote.enabled
AI Marketer_HIDE_STARTUP_MESSAGElogger.startup.enabled
AI Marketer_DISABLE_UPDATE_NOTIFICATIONlogger.updates.enabled

移行手順

環境内でこれらの環境変数のいずれかを無効にしていた場合は、適切な値を追加することで /config/server.js を更新してください:

/config/server.js
module.exports = ({ env }) => ({
// … 他の設定オプション
transfer: {
remote: {
enabled: false, // AI Marketer_DISABLE_REMOTE_DATA_TRANSFER の代わりにリモートデータ転送を無効化
},
},
logger: {
updates: {
enabled: false, // AI Marketer_DISABLE_UPDATE_NOTIFICATION の代わりに更新通知ログを無効化
},
startup: {
enabled: false, // AI Marketer_HIDE_STARTUP_MESSAGE の代わりにスタートアップメッセージを無効化
},
},
});